Jessica Padgett, a 33-year-old Pennsylvania woman, was last seen on Nov. 21. when she left her job at a daycare center. Five days later, Jessica’s stepfather was placed under arrest after police discovered her body buried behind a shed on the property owned by Padgett’s mother. Grisly details are now being revealed, including an “abuse of corpse” charge logged against the accused 53-year-old.
Writes People.com on Dec. 7: “Necrophilia motivated a man to fatally shoot his stepdaughter last month, according to a Pennsylvania prosecutor. Gregory Graf recorded himself sexually abusing the body of Jessica Padgett, Northampton County District Attorney John Morganelli said Friday. The video was discovered a day earlier on Graf's computer, the prosecutor said.”
Graf, from Allen Township, was charged with misdemeanor necrophilia to go along with the previous murder charge. He has been jailed at the Northampton County Prison since late November. On Nov. 21, Padgett left her work, telling her fellow employees that she had to use a fax machine at her mother’s house, located nearby. She never returned.
After being interviewed and showing an inability to resolve “unexplained inconsistencies,” Graf admitted to shooting Padgett in the head and burying her body. Before he did so, he violated the corpse – and filmed himself doing so. The tape was turned over to investigators.
“We know she died of a gunshot wound and we haven't excluded necrophilia as a possible motive in the killing,” said Northampton County District Attorney John Morganelli. “His possible motive was to have a sexual relationship with the body.”
Adds CBS News: “Officials said Wednesday afternoon that they believe Graf killed Padgett in his home and then drove her vehicle to the dollar store parking lot where he retrieved his own vehicle, which he had parked there earlier. Authorities say they are working to determine whether the murder was premeditated. Padgett's mother was away in Florida at the time of the murder, according to police.”
Padgett was a mother of two. Her family released a statement, which read in part: “She was a beautiful, vibrant young woman who was loved by her family and friends. The world shines less bright today.”
